Professional Background
Aman Ahuja is a distinguished professional focused on enhancing the capacity of civil society to proficiently and ethically leverage data. With extensive expertise in product strategy and data governance, Aman has worked closely with various product teams, advising leaders while establishing robust frameworks for data products and collaborations. His career illustrates a deep commitment to intertwining technology with social impact, particularly in areas such as climate change and social justice.
Among his notable achievements, Aman has collaborated with the prestigious Rockefeller Foundation. In this role, he was instrumental in developing and supporting data products and strategies designed for the foundation's grantees and partners. His work at the Rockefeller Foundation highlights his ability to merge technical acumen with a vision for creating sustainable, impactful data solutions.
Further showcasing his innovative spirit, Aman led a team in South Australia to design, develop, and pilot a groundbreaking peer-to-peer energy trading solution. This project ingeniously combined solar energy, battery storage, and smart meters, encapsulated within a user-friendly app, and implemented an agent-based marketplace that transformed how energy is traded and consumed. This endeavor not only reflects his technical abilities but also his dedication to building a sustainable energy future, contributing to climate change mitigation efforts.
Aman's leadership extended to The Data Guild, where he spearheaded the design and promotion of a platform aimed at improving the efficiency of clinical trials. This initiative addressed stagnation and vendor lock-in challenges while adhering to stringent compliance and regulatory requirements. His strategic foresight in this project epitomizes his ability to drive innovation within complex environments.
In addition to his technical projects, Aman has made significant contributions to public policy. He partnered with a prominent US public policy think tank to define key objectives and develop roadmaps for a multi-stakeholder initiative focused on the critical issues of property rights insecurity and loss within the United States. This work reflects his comprehensive understanding of the intersection between data, policy, and social equity.
Moreover, Aman collaborated with a local county justice department to create governance and infrastructure for a data system that yields insights into recidivism. His efforts in this domain illustrate a profound commitment to addressing social justice issues, utilizing data as a tool for transformation and reform.
A significant part of Aman's career is dedicated to advancing the responsible use of machine learning. He has conceived implementation strategies and proofs-of-concept for innovative products that integrate machine learning technologies, particularly emphasizing differential privacy. This focus on privacy in data usage is vital in today's data-driven landscape and highlights his forward-thinking approach to technology.
Lastly, Aman is the founder of the San Francisco Bay Area chapter of DataKind. Through this role, he played a pivotal part in establishing and cultivating sustainable networks and processes dedicated to promoting the effective use of data for social good. His commitment to building communities around data illustrates his passion for fostering collaboration and shared learning.
Education and Achievements
Aman Ahuja's educational journey began at Fairview High School, where he laid a solid foundation for his future academic pursuits. He furthered his education by earning a Bachelor of Science degree in Electrical Engineering from Worcester Polytechnic Institute. His academic background has equipped him with the technical skills and analytical abilities necessary to succeed in various complex roles throughout his career.
As he transitioned from academia to professional practice, Aman has amassed a wealth of experience in various organizations. He currently contributes his expertise in data product strategy at Fenris Technologies Inc, where he continues to foster innovation and strategy development in the data domain.
In previous roles, Aman served on the Board of Directors at Aspiration Tech, a position that allowed him to influence technological advancements aimed at promoting equitable development in communities. He has also contributed his insights as a member of the Advisory Council at Not In Our Town, advocating for community-led initiatives against hate crimes and promoting safety for all citizens.
Additionally, Aman has been a Senior Member and Consultant at The Data Guild, where he has leveraged his rich background in data strategy to provide advisory services and mentorship to emerging data professionals.
